Rainbow Nation wins Grand Prix

There was more than gold at the end of the rainbow for Coca-Cola South Africa and its marketing communication agency, FCB Joburg, at the 2014 Loerie Awards this weekend (Saturday September 20, Sunday September 21, 2014).

The team was one of the best performing of the show, winning no less than six Loeries, including one of just four Grand Prix awards made over the weekend for its inspirational #RainbowNation activation during Freedom Month.

Using sunlight, water, some fancy science and a little bit of magic, the rainbows were conjured up in the Johannesburg CBD by FCB Joburg and a technical team led by a globe-trotting rainbow-maker from the United States. The moments of happiness created by the Coca-Cola rainbows were captured on film, and shared over the social media networks.


The Loerie Awards Show is South Africa’s premier advertising and marketing communication event. Internationally recognised, it is the only award endorsed by the Association for Communication and Advertising (ACA), the Brand Council South Africa (BCSA), the Creative Circle (CC), and other professional bodies making up the marketing community. Winning a Loerie – Bronze, Silver or Gold – is regarded as the highlight of any agency’s year; winning one of the scarce Grand Prix often as the highlight of a creative team’s career.

Coca-Cola South Africa and FCB Joburg’s wins were:

Grand Prix - Outdoor & Collateral Media - A Rainbow for a Rainbow Nation

Gold - Media Innovation: Single Medium -A Rainbow for a Rainbow Nation

Gold- Events & PR: PR Campaign - A Rainbow for a Rainbow Nation

Bronze - Integrated Campaign - A Rainbow for a Rainbow Nation

Craft Gold- TV, Film & Video Communication: Best Use of Licenced Music - Bobby (Share a Coke With)

Bronze -TV, Film & Video Communication: TV & Cinema Ads Up to 90seconds - Bobby (Share a Coke With)


FCB Joburg also won three Loeries for its radio work for Toyota South Africa and Lexus, FCB Cape Town won a Bronze Loerie for its radio work for Savanna Dry and a Bronze Loerie was awarded to FCB South Africa/Hellocomputer for the ‘Labello Electric Kiss’ activation entered in the digital & interactive – applications activations and interactive tools category.
